What is there to see and do in Exeter?
Make a point to visit attractions such as Crealy Great Adventure Park and Topsham Pool. During your stay, visit sights such as Exeter Cathedral, Spacex and Exeter's Historic Quayside. Exeter appeals to visitors with its bar scene and stunning cathedral.
When is the best time to book a hotel with a pool in Exeter?
Taking the local weather in Exeter into account is an important factor for planning your visit, especially if you plan to spend your trip by the pool.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Exeter is 843 mm.
